SN74LVC240ADWR Equivalent & Substitute Parts

Part Overview

The SN74LVC240ADWR is an inverting buffer logic integrated circuit manufactured by Texas Instruments, designed for 3-state output applications in digital systems. This 20-SOIC surface mount device operates across a supply voltage range of 1.65V to 3.6V and maintains active product status with full RoHS3 compliance. Key Parameters

Parameter Value
Logic Type Buffer, Inverting
Number of Elements 2
Number of Bits per Element 4
Output Type 3-State
Current - Output High, Low 24mA, 24mA
Voltage - Supply 1.65V ~ 3.6V
Operating Temperature -40°C ~ 125°C (TA)
Mounting Type Surface Mount
Package / Case 20-SOIC (0.295", 7.50mm Width)
RoHS Status ROHS3 Compliant
Moisture Sensitivity Level 1 (Unlimited)

Substitute Part Grouping Explanation

Substitution eligibility for the SN74LVC240ADWR is determined by the following critical parameters:

  • Logic configuration: Buffer, Inverting with 2 elements, 4 bits per element
  • Output architecture: 3-State output capability
  • Output current capability: 24mA high and low
  • Package form factor: 20-SOIC surface mount
  • Supply voltage compatibility: Minimum 1.65V operation required
  • Operating temperature range: Minimum -40°C to 125°C coverage required
  • Compliance certifications: RoHS3 status

The identified substitute parts maintain functional equivalence across these core parameters while accommodating variations in supply voltage floor, operating temperature ceiling, packaging format (Tape & Reel vs. Cut Tape), and moisture sensitivity classification.

Parameter Comparison

Parameter SN74LVC240ADWR (TI) 74LVC240AD,118 (Nexperia) MC74LCX240DWR2G (onsemi)
Manufacturer Texas Instruments Nexperia USA Inc. onsemi
Logic Type Buffer, Inverting Buffer, Inverting Buffer, Inverting
Number of Elements 2 2 2
Number of Bits per Element 4 4 4
Output Type 3-State 3-State 3-State
Current - Output High, Low 24mA, 24mA 24mA, 24mA 24mA, 24mA
Voltage - Supply 1.65V ~ 3.6V 1.2V ~ 3.6V 2V ~ 3.6V
Operating Temperature -40°C ~ 125°C -40°C ~ 125°C -40°C ~ 85°C
Mounting Type Surface Mount Surface Mount Surface Mount
Package / Case 20-SOIC 20-SOIC 20-SOIC
Packaging Format Cut Tape (CT) & Digi-Reel® Tape & Reel (TR) Tape & Reel (TR)
RoHS Status ROHS3 Compliant ROHS3 Compliant ROHS3 Compliant
Moisture Sensitivity Level 1 (Unlimited) 1 (Unlimited) 3 (168 Hours)
Product Status Active Active Active

Engineering Selection Recommendations

74LVC240AD,118 (Nexperia USA Inc.) provides direct functional substitution with extended lower supply voltage operation (1.2V floor versus 1.65V) and maintains the full operating temperature range of -40°C to 125°C. This part is available in Tape & Reel packaging and carries MSL 1 classification, matching the moisture sensitivity profile of the primary part. All compliance certifications align with the SN74LVC240ADWR.

MC74LCX240DWR2G (onsemi) maintains functional equivalence across core logic parameters and output specifications. This part operates within a 2V to 3.6V supply range and supports the -40°C to 85°C temperature window. The operating temperature ceiling is reduced by 40°C compared to the primary part. This device carries MSL 3 classification, requiring controlled storage conditions (168-hour maximum floor life). Selection of this substitute is appropriate when the reduced temperature range and moisture sensitivity requirements align with application constraints.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Can the 74LVC240AD,118 be used as a direct replacement for the SN74LVC240ADWR?

A: Yes. Both parts share identical logic configuration (2-element, 4-bit inverting buffer with 3-state output), output current ratings (24mA), package form factor (20-SOIC), and operating temperature range (-40°C to 125°C). The Nexperia part extends lower supply voltage operation to 1.2V and maintains MSL 1 moisture sensitivity. Packaging format differs (Tape & Reel versus Cut Tape), which may affect procurement and handling procedures.

Q: What are the limitations of the MC74LCX240DWR2G substitute?

A: The onsemi part operates within a reduced temperature range (-40°C to 85°C maximum, versus 125°C for the primary part) and requires a minimum supply voltage of 2V rather than 1.65V. Moisture sensitivity is classified as MSL 3, requiring storage within 168-hour floor life limits. These constraints must be evaluated against specific application requirements before selection.

Q: Are all three parts pin-compatible?

A: All three parts utilize the 20-SOIC package form factor with identical pinout configuration, enabling direct PCB-level substitution without layout modification.

Q: What compliance certifications apply to all substitute options?

A: All three parts maintain RoHS3 compliance, REACH Unaffected status, and EAR99 export classification. HTSUS code 8542.39.0001 applies uniformly across all options.

Q: How does packaging format affect part selection?

A: The SN74LVC240ADWR is supplied in Cut Tape and Digi-Reel format, while both substitute parts are available in Tape & Reel packaging. Tape & Reel format is standard for automated assembly processes and typically offers cost advantages in high-volume production. Cut Tape format accommodates lower-volume or manual assembly workflows. Functional performance is unaffected by packaging format.
